  13. Well first off, I would go by the method that phpBB has to create a user. Try this function to create one. http://wiki.phpbb.com/Add_users Now, to load phpBB's functions... Since your saying you file is located in: /home/ And you forums directory is: /home/forum/ phpBB requires that you define a few things before you load it. You need this: <?php define('MY_ROOT', dirname(__FILE__)); // This the the AutoReg.php file location. define('IN_PHPBB', true); // Checked by phpBB $phpEx = substr(strrchr(__FILE__, '.'), 1); // Needed by phpBB $phpbb_root_path = MY_ROOOT . '/forum/'; // The forums root. include($phpbb_root_path . 'common.' . $phpEx); // The file loader. include($phpbb_root_path . 'includes/functions_user.php'); include($phpbb_root_path . 'includes/ucp/ucp_register.php'); // Now do what you please.... From there, you can either user that user_add() function or whatever you would like.
